Feature Overview

The iStartek VT202 is a compact GPS tracker designed for motorcycles, electric bicycles, cars, and a range of light vehicles. It combines position reporting with anti-theft alarms and a remote cut-off capability, providing core tools for location awareness and basic fleet or asset protection.

  • Mini form factor suitable for discreet installation on motorcycles, e bikes, and cars
  • Built-in GPS positioning with supplementary LBS positioning for improved coverage
  • Multiple anti-theft alarms including vibration alarm, wire cut-off alarm, and ACC alarm
  • Remote cut-off function to stop the vehicle by breaking fuel connection when supported and configured
  • Reporting and tracking via SMS, mobile app, and web interfaces for flexible monitoring

Core Features of iStartek - VT202

  • Compact design intended for motorcycle and electric bicycle tracking as well as car management
  • Built-in GPS module for precise position data
  • LBS based positioning to supplement GPS in weak signal areas
  • Wide input voltage range for use across different vehicle types including trucks and trailers
  • Vibration alarm to detect movement or tampering
  • Wire cut-off alarm to notify if power or wiring is severed
  • ACC alarm to indicate ignition state changes
  • Remote cut-off (fuel break) capability to assist in theft response when supported by firmware and installation

Feature Availability Notes

  • Feature set can differ between firmware versions and hardware revisions; check device firmware release notes for exact behavior
  • Some functions, like remote cut-off, require correct wiring and installation and may be restricted by local regulations
  • LBS positioning reliability depends on cellular network coverage and may vary by region
  • Alarm sensitivity and behavior may be configurable; installer setup can affect how and when alarms trigger
  • Manufacturer region variants or optional accessories can change available features
